| #1hairyscotsman2Aug 21, 2010 19:45:01 | A player has asked a resonable question. What familiars can they have? We can certainly remove some existing ones but they have added none. Any Ideas anyone? This player was interested in bluff and intimidate bonuses. z'tal in previous edition gave intimidate bonus. they were lizards so equating them to lizards is easy enough they were immune to mental powers themselves so Z'tal Lizard Familiar Senses Low-light vision Speed 6 Constant Benefits You gain a +2 bonus to Intimidate and Athletics checks. You gain resist 5 psychic. If you already have resist psychic, increase it by 2. Your resist psychic increases by 2 while you are bloodied. Active Benefits Lizard’s Immunity: The Z'tal lizard is immune to psychic. Any more anyone? Previous 3.5 edition list is below: critic, lizard floater hurrum, speckled jankx kes'trekel - athasian take on hawk? mulworm ramphor snake, tiny viper - equate to serpent z'tal |
| #2tindalosihoundAug 21, 2010 23:07:10 | Back in ol' 2e, the athasian list of familiars was still pretty mundane. Bat (In Arcane Power) Beetle (Probably the speckled Hurrum of 3e) Black Cat (In Arcane Power) Psuedodragon (Use Arcane Power's Dragonling) Rat (In Arcane Power) Scorpion Snake (In Arcane Power) Dragon Magazine also has some more familiars in 374 Weasel stats could work for Jankx, Oozes would make passable Mulworms, and Arcane Eyes could be used for Floater polyps. Other potential creatures for familiars could be: Baazrag (Use Dragon Magazine 374's Badger), Ock'n, Silt Spiders (Spiders from Arcane Power), |
